自定义菜单的实现方法及装置制造方法及图纸

技术编号:3975193 阅读:210 留言:0更新日期:2012-04-11 18:40
本发明专利技术实施例提供了一种自定义菜单的实现方法及装置。所述方法包括:首先识别用户在所述移动终端触摸屏上输入的轨迹图形;然后判断所输入的轨迹图形和所述用户在移动终端上预先设定的自定义轨迹图形是否一致;若一致,则进入预先设定的与所述自定义轨迹图形相对应的功能界面。通过上述技术方案的实施,就能够采用新的菜单操作形式,方便了用户操作,从而提高了用户的操作感受。

【技术实现步骤摘要】

本专利技术涉及移动终端领域,尤其涉及一种自定义菜单的实现方法及装置
技术介绍
目前,在移动终端的应用中,触摸屏已成为主流设计,然而移动终端传统的菜单形 式已变得相当的乏味,移动终端中常见的菜单形式可以分为两个阶段最原始的是使用文 字作为菜单,虽然望文知意,但显得很死板;之后出现了图形菜单,但图形菜单只是让菜单 更加直观和生动,在菜单形式和操作方式上仍然延续了最开始所使用的传统模式,即分层 分级的菜单模式。上述的移动终端可以包括手机、笔记本电脑、PDA、数字播放器等终端设 备。从上述现有技术可知,目前的移动终端几乎都采用图形菜单,使用传统的分层分 级菜单模式来进行操作,用户需要通过移动终端的制造商,例如手机制造商所提供的菜单 顺序,一层层的进入想要进入的界面,并执行想要使用的操作功能,这种菜单方式操作繁 琐,使用方式陈旧,影响了用户操作感受。
技术实现思路
本专利技术实施例提供了一种自定义菜单的实现方法及装置,能够采用新的菜单操作 形式,方便用户操作,从而提高了用户的操作感受。本专利技术实施例提供了一种自定义菜单的实现方法,所述方法包括识别用户在所述移动终端触摸屏上输入的轨迹图形;判断所输入的轨迹图形和所述用户在移动终端上预先设定的自定义轨迹图形是否一致;若一致,则进入预先设定的与所述自定义轨迹图形相对应的功能界面。本专利技术实施例还提供了一种自定义菜单的实现装置,包括对应关系建立单元,用于根据用户在移动终端触摸屏上所输入的自定义轨迹图 形,预先设定所述自定义轨迹图形与相应功能界面之间的对应关系;轨迹图形识别单元,用于识别在所述移动终端触摸屏上输入的轨迹图形;轨迹图形判断单元,用于判断所述轨迹图形识别单元所识别出的轨迹图形和所述 对应关系建立单元所保存的自定义轨迹图形是否一致,若一致,则进入预先设定的与所述 自定义轨迹图形相对应的功能界面。由上述所提供的技术方案可以看出,首先识别用户在所述移动终端触摸屏上输入 的轨迹图形;然后判断所输入的轨迹图形和所述用户在移动终端触摸屏上预先输入的自定 义轨迹图形是否一致;若一致,则进入预先设定的与所述自定义轨迹图形相对应的功能界 面。通过上述技术方案的实施,就能够采用新的菜单操作形式,方便了用户操作,从而提高 了用户的操作感受。附图说明图1为本专利技术实施例1所提供方法的流程示意图;图2为本专利技术实施例所举出实例“勾”的记录示意图;图3为本专利技术实施例所举出实例“圆”的记录示意图;图4为本专利技术实施例所举出实例“圆”的曲线之间角度记录的示意图;图5为本专利技术实施例所举出实例“2”的记录示意图;图6为本专利技术实施例所举出的“新建短信”界面建立对应关系的示意图;图7为本专利技术实施例所举出的例子中用户再次输入的示意图;图8为本专利技术实施例所举出的例子中进入“新建短信”界面的示意图;图9为本专利技术实施例所提供实现装置的结构示意图。具体实施例方式本专利技术实施例提供了 一种自定义菜单的实现方法及装置,通过任意画出的轨迹或 图形,用户可以定义自己的菜单和快捷方式,从而方便了用户操作,提高了用户的操作感受。为更好的描述本专利技术实施例,现结合附图对本专利技术的具体实施例进行说明,如图1 所示为本专利技术实施例1所提供方法的流程示意图,图中包括步骤11 预先设定自定义轨迹图形与相应功能界面之间的对应关系。在该步骤中,首先用户在移动终端触摸屏上输入自定义轨迹图形,然后根据用户 所输入的自定义轨迹图形,就可以预先设定所述自定义轨迹图形与相应功能界面之间的对 应关系。上述用户所输入的自定义轨迹图形可以是由用户根据自己的想法任意画出的轨迹 或图形。在具体实现过程中,用户在移动终端触摸屏上输入自定义轨迹图形之后,可以先 保存用户所输入自定义轨迹图形的相关信息,然后再预先设定所述自定义轨迹图形与所述 用户需要实现的功能界面之间的对应关系。保存所输入自定义轨迹图形相关信息的方法可 以有多种,例如可以先将用户在移动终端触摸屏上所输入的自定义轨迹图形分解成各种图 形;然后再保存各分解图形以及各分解图形之间的角度,也就是说可以将自定义轨迹图形 按照矢量图的方式进行保存,即通过数学方法的描述来进行保存;上述所分解成的各图形 可以包括以下一种或多种基本元素横线、竖线、斜线、曲线或圆形,例如分解成横线和竖线 的组合,或横线和曲线的组合等。下面以具体的实例说明如何按照矢量图的方式来记录用户的输入,其基本思路是 将自定义轨迹图形分解成各种简单图形元素的组合;然后记录存储分解图形,以及各分解 图形之间的角度,这样的好处是可以解决用户前后两次输入图形的大小、长短不一致的问 题;然后再根据上述的记录来判断用户前后两次输入的图形是否相似或一致。上述实例的实现过程并没有考虑到笔顺,可以认为所输入的图形从左向右或从右 向左是同一个图形;若考虑笔顺也是可以实现的,具体可以通过扩展来实现。以一个简单的例子来说,用户在移动终端触摸屏上输入自定义轨迹图形“勾 (V )”,如图2所示为本实施例所举出实例“勾”的记录示意图,图2中用户输入自定义轨 迹图形所经过的点阵记录为真(true),所以将图中为true的记录下来。首先根据点阵趋势来判断该图形“V”是由两部分组成的,这里趋势的解释就是X,y的坐标都增加,或者都减小,或者一个增加一个减小的情况。然后记录下该图形“ V,,的其中一部分图形所经过点的坐标,其中将x坐标相同的 放到了 一列中,具体如下A A A A A A A A A 上述的点阵表示x,y坐标是一起增加的,并且比较中点的位置,发现点的位置与 划过的轨迹误差很小;然后再判断中点分别于A 和A 的中点的位置,发现与划 过的轨迹误差也很小,所以认为该部分图形是一条线,并且不是直线而是斜线;同理,也可 判断出另一部分图形也是斜线。并可以计算出上述两条斜线的角度,然后就可以记录存储该自定义轨迹图形“V” 是由两斜线组成的,以及这两条斜线之间的角度。下面在举出一个记录保存自定义轨迹图形“圆(〇)”的具体实例,如图3所示为本 实施例所举出实例“圆”的记录示意图,按照上述的趋势判断方法可知,该自定义轨迹图形 “〇”是由四部分组成的,以其中一部分为例来进行说明,拿第一象限来说,其点阵记录为A A A A A A A A A A A A A A A A A A A A 在上述点阵中,取出两个端点的坐标,算出端点A和A的中点为 A ,而用户划过的轨迹为A 小于A ;同理再分别判断A 与A , A 与A 的中点;然后比较发现用户划过的轨迹都是比相应的中点要小, 所以可以认为用户为凸的曲线;反之,如果都大,则为凹的曲线。用上述的方式再对其他象限的图形进行判断和记录,然后把四个趋势改变的点连 接起来,算出相互之间直接的角度,并记录下来,如图4所示为本实施例所举出实例“圆”的 曲线之间角度记录的示意图。最终所记录的该自定义轨迹图形“〇”的信息就为四个凸的 曲线,以及四个曲线相互之间的角度。在举一个例子来说,对于自定义轨迹图形“2”来说,如图5所示为本实施例所举出 实例“2”的记录示意图,通过上述的判断方法,就可以得出该自定义轨迹图形“2”为两个凸 的曲线,一个斜线,一个直线,以及三个角度。在具体实现过程中,角度相差可以存在一定的误差,该误差可以预先进行设定,只 要在误本文档来自技高网...

【技术保护点】
一种自定义菜单的实现方法,其特征在于,所述方法包括:识别用户在所述移动终端触摸屏上输入的轨迹图形;判断所输入的轨迹图形和所述用户在移动终端上预先设定的自定义轨迹图形是否一致;若一致,则进入预先设定的与所述自定义轨迹图形相对应的功能界面。

【技术特征摘要】

【专利技术属性】
技术研发人员:李游由思元
申请(专利权)人:华为终端有限公司
类型:发明
国别省市:94[中国|深圳]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1